2025 | Circular Monday – Record Global Reach
Circular Monday reached 108 million people across 58 countries in 2025, entirely organically and without paid marketing or advertising. The campaign united 1,456+ businesses, organizations, and influencers, reinforcing circular consumption as a global cultural movement and alternative to Black Friday.
